رفتن به مطلب

mrasoul

عضو سایت
  • تعداد ارسال‌ها

    253
  • تاریخ عضویت

  • آخرین بازدید

  • روز های برد

    1

نوشته‌ها ارسال شده توسط mrasoul

  1. سلام

    اینو بزارید تو فایل دیدگاهتون


    <?php
    // Do not delete these lines
    if (!empty($_SERVER['SCRIPT_FILENAME']) && 'comments.php' == basename($_SERVER['SCRIPT_FILENAME']))
    die ('Please do not load this page directly. Thanks!');
    if ( post_password_required() ) { ?>
    <p class="nocomments">این مطلب خصوصی است.در صورتی که رمز آن را دارید در قسمت زیر وارد کنید.</p>
    <?php
    return;
    }
    ?>
    <div id="wow fadeInUp">
    <h3>
    <?php comments_number( 'پاسخی برای این مطلب ارائه نشده است' , '1 پاسخ ثبت شده برای این مطلب' , '% پاسخ ثبت شده برای این مطلب' );?>
    </h3>
    <?php if( have_comments ):?>
    <ol class="commentslist">
    <?php wp_list_comments('avatar_size=55&type=comment');?>
    </ol>
    <div class="navigation">
    <div class="alignleft">
    <?php previous_comments_link() ?>
    </div>
    <div class="alignright">
    <?php next_comments_link() ?>
    </div>
    </div>
    <?php else : // this is displayed if there are no comments so far ?>
    <?php if ('open' == $post->comment_status) : ?>
    <!-- If comments are open, but there are no comments. -->
    <?php else : // comments are closed ?>
    <!-- If comments are closed. -->
    <p class="nocomments">نظرات بسته شده است.</p>
    <?php endif; ?>
    <?php endif; ?>
    <?php if ('open' == $post->comment_status) : ?>
    <div id="respond">
    <?php if ( get_option('comment_registration') && !$user_ID ) : ?>
    <p>شما باید <a href="<?php echo get_option('siteurl'); ?>/wp-login.php?redirect_to=<?php echo urlencode(get_permalink()); ?>">وارد سایت شوید</a> تا بتوانید نظر دهید.</p>
    <?php else : ?>
    <form action="<?php echo get_option('siteurl')?>/wp-comments-post.php" method="post" role="form" id="commentform">
    <div class="reza wow fadeInUp">
    <?php if( $user_ID ):?>
    <span class="wow fadeInUp" style="font:18px 'Mj_Dinar two';color:rgba(211,0,3,1.00); margin-top:15px;">ارسال دیدگاه</span><br />
    <a href="<?php echo get_option('siteurl');?>/wp-admin/profile.php"><?php echo $user_identity; ?></a> <span><?php print 'عزیز، شما لاگین و مجاز به ارسال دیدگاه هستید .' ;?></span> <a href="<?php echo wp_logout_url( get_permalink()); ?>"><?php print 'خارج می شوید؟'; ?></a> </div>
    <?php else: ?>

    <!---- s ------>
    <legend class="wow fadeInUp" style="font:18px 'Mj_Dinar two';color:rgba(211,0,3,1.00); margin-top:15px;">همه گزینه ها الزامیست.</legend>
    <div class="form-group wow fadeInUp">
    <input type="text" name="name" class="form-control txt-f" id="name" value="<?php echo $comment_author; ?>" placeholder="نام خود را وارد کنید" tabindex="1" />
    </div>
    <div class="form-group wow fadeInUp">
    <input type="email" name="email" class="form-control txt-f" id="email" <?php if ($req) echo "aria-required='true'"; ?> value="<?php echo $comment_author_email; ?>" placeholder="آدرس ایمیل خود را وارد کنید" tabindex="2" />
    </div>
    <div class="form-group wow fadeInUp">
    <input type="url" id="url" class="form-control txt-f" placeholder="آدرس سایت / وبلاگ خود را وارد کنید" tabindex="3" />
    </div>
    <?php endif; ?>
    <!---- s ------>

    <!---- s ------>
    <div class="form-group wow fadeInUp">
    <textarea name="comment" class="form-control" id="comment" placeholder="متن دیدگاه خود را وارد کنید" rows="6" tabindex="4"></textarea>
    </div>
    <div class="icon-com wow fadeInUp">
    <?php do_action('comment_form', $post->ID); ?>
    </div>
    <div class="clearfix"></div>
    <input type="submit" name="submit" class="btn btn-warning btn-large pull-left" id="submit" tabindex="5" value="ارسال" />


    <?php comment_id_fields(); ?>
    <!---- s ------>
    </form>
    <?php endif; ?>
    </div>
    <?php endif; ?>
    </div>

    lمشکل برطرف نشد . من تگهای مربوط به comment form دیفالت رو میخوام . الان روی قالب من حالت دیفالت فرم دیدگاه وجود داره که میخوام ویرایشش کنم اما نمیشه

  2. خب زمانی که نرم افزار های خودش رو بذار روی یه هاست جدا با ساب دامنه www.dl.example.com و عکس های خودش رو در مسیر upload یا هر مسیر دیگه ای آپلود کنه که همه چیز سر جای خودشه...

    تا جایی که من خبر دارم سایت های بزرگ کشورمون هم همینجوری عمل میکنن که اگه نیاز به ارتقاع هاست باشه هزینه ی اضافی پرداخت نکنن. پست پاک کردنم که فوقش 2 تا فایل دانلود پاک میکنن 3 تا عکس :|

    ___

    البتّه حرف شما و من فرقی نمیکنه ، من فقط میگم که برای عکس ها لازم نیست که ساب دامین درست کنن...

    اینکه 2 تا هاست داشته باشی خودش میشه پول اضافه ؟!

    مثلا دانلود ها :

    dl.downloadha.com

    img.downloadha.com

    البته این نظر شخصیه منه و من اینجوری عمل میکنم

    • امتیاز 2
  3. خب اگه قرار باشه که عکس ها رو توی هاست اصلی بذاری که فرقی نمیکنه ، چه ساب دامین داشته باشی چه ساب دامین نداشته باشی...

    اگه سایت دانلود داری برای نرم افزار هات حتماً از هاست دانلود استفاده کن...

    عکس ها هم حالا حالا ها هاست اصلی که 15 گیگابایت باشه پر نمیکنن و نیازی هم به ساخت ساب دامین ندارن

    (اگر میخوای بهشون نظم بدی یه پوشه خاص تو هاستت براشون انتخاب کن) که البتّه فایده ای هم نداره... چون نرم افزار ها که توی هاست دانلودت هستن پس فقط میمونن عکس ها که میرن توی uploads

    موفّّق باشی... نیازی به ساخت ساب دامین نیست

    من صرفا برای نظم دادن به عکس ها و نرم افزار ها گفتم اینطوری هرچیز سر جای خودش هست نرم افزار یک پوشه عکس ها یک پوشه حالا یا میتونه ساب دامین بسازه یا یک پوشه مخصوص آپلود که در این صوت خود وردپرس پوشه آپلود داره و میتونه از همون استفاده کنه .

    سایتهای خیلی بزرگ اگه به این صورت که شما میگی عمل کنند ، وقتی نیاز باشه یکسر از پستهایی که منسوخ شده اند را پاک کنند امکانش وجود نداره یا خیلی سخته و یکسری فایلها همیشه باید روی هاستشون باشه در صورتی که تعداد دانلودشون شاید سالانه 1 بار باشه

    • امتیاز 2
  4. این کد ویدئویی را فراخوانی می کنه که پیوست مطلبتون شده باشه برای قرار دادن لینک ویدئو هایی که قبلا دانلود کردید مستقیما از شورت کد در خود مطلب استفاده کنید


    [video src="نشانی ویدئو"]

    مشکل برطرف شد . کلا ویدئو رو به صورت زمینه دلخواه درآوردم اینجوری خیلی بهتره . چون قرار ویدئو ها در پوشه ی خاصی قرار بگیره پس همیشه از آدرس ویدئو استفاده میکنم که زمینه دلخواه بهتر است از سیستم آپلود خود وردپرس

  5. اونیکه قبل از ویدئو نشون داده می شه اسمش اینتروست نه پوستر پوستر یک فایل تصویری از جنس jpg باید باشه که همونطور که از اسمش مشخصه پوستر ویدئو باشه

    اینترو رو باید یا به وسیله activex در فلاش و بر روی پلیر بنویسید (مثل آپارات) یا قبل از ویدئوی اصلی ران کنید

    یکم بیشتر توضیح میدید که چجوری بنویسم ؟ یعنی یک صفحه ای هست که جزئی از ویدئو ست ؟ من مخیوام چندتا اینترو باشه

  6. مثلا این کد

    <div style="position:fixed; right:84%; top:86%; float:left; border:1px #999 solid; padding:6px; background:#FCFBF7; width:135px; border-radius: 20px;

    -moz-border-radius: 10px; font-family:tahoma; font-size:11px; "><div>♥امتیاز بدهید♥</div>  <center>

    <g:plusone size="medium" href="<?php the_permalink(); ?>"></g:plusone>

    </a></center></div>

    دکمه گوگل پلاس سمته چپ پایین قرار میگیره... و همینطور که میبینی میشه به بالا و راست تنظیمش کرد برای جای دلخواه

    تو به هرجا بخوای میتونی تنظیمش کنی کافیه float:left رو بدی float:right

  7. من میخوام بر روی ویدئو های سایت پوستر قرار بدم . از تگ زیر استفاده کردم و پوستر و ویدئو رو با زمینه دلخواه تو پوسته قرار دادم مشکل اینجاست قبل از play کردن ویدئو فقط پوستر نشون داده میشه و من میخوام وقتی ویدئو رو play میکنیم 5 ثانیه نشون بده پوستر رو بعد ویدئو رو پخش کنه .


    <?php $post = get_the_ID(); ?>
    <?php $video = get_post_meta($post, 'video', true);?>
    <?php $poster = get_post_meta($post, 'poster', true);?>
    <?php echo do_shortcode( '[video src="'.$video.'" poster="'.$poster.'"]') ?>

    مثل پوسترهای آپارات میخوام که اول ویدئو مشخصه و وقتی که ویدئو play میشه پوستر 5 ثانیه نشون داده میشه .

    البته من فکر کنم 2 تا ویدئو باشه نه پوستر حالا کسی راهی سراغ داره که راهنمایی منه تا منم چنین حرکتی بزنم

  8. یه مشکله خیلی بزرگ داره این تگ ها . اینکه اگر تو داشبور ویدئو آپ کنی بزاری اوکی میشه . اما اگه از یودئو های قدیمی بخوای استفاده کنی و وارد کنی ویدئو رو نشون نمیده

    یا اینکه وقتی آدرس ویدئو را از جای دیگه هاست وارد کنی نشون نمیده ویدئو رو فقط باید از طریق داشبورد آپ کنیم و بعد اینسرت بزنیم

    این کار رو خراب کرده


    [video src="'.$mylink.'"]

  9. با عرض سلام

    تو قالب سایتم با قسمت دیدگاه ها مشکل دارم . مشکلم اینه که نمیدونم چجوری قسمت فرمهای دیدگاه رو ویرایش کنم . یعنی قسمت مربوط به نوشتن دیدگاه ، فید نام ، فید ایمیل و فید وبلاگ .

    comments


    <div class="comments">
    <?php if (post_password_required()) : ?>
    <p><?php _e( 'Post is password protected. Enter the password to view any comments.', 'html5blank' ); ?></p>
    </div>
    <?php return; endif; ?>
    <?php if (have_comments()) : ?>
    <ul>
    <?php wp_list_comments('type=comment&callback=html5blankcomments'); // Custom callback in functions.php ?>
    </ul>
    <?php elseif ( ! comments_open() && ! is_page() && post_type_supports( get_post_type(), 'comments' ) ) : ?>
    <p><?php _e( 'Comments are closed here.', 'html5blank' ); ?></p>
    <?php endif; ?>
    <?php comment_form(); ?>
    </div>

    همانطور که تو کدهای بالا معلومه اصلا قسمت فرم دیدگاهمعلوم نیست .

    البته تو این لینک توضیحاتی داده اما نفهمیدم چیکار باید کنم http://codex.wordpress.org/Function_Reference/comment_form


  10. <?php if ( is_user_logged_in() ) { ?>
    دکمه اول
    <?php } else { ?>
    دکمه دوم
    <?php } ?>

    اینو یکی از دوستان همینجا بهم داده با استفاده از این کد فهموندم که در صورت لاگین بودن کاربر در سایت یه دکمه نشون بده و در صورت لاگین نبودن یه دکمه دیگه

    • امتیاز 1
  11. نه عزیز

    بخاطر همینه که هیچ راه حلی نمیتونم پیدا کنم!

    میخوام اون چیزی که توضیح دادم انجام بشه،خیلیم برام ضروریه!

    امیدوارم دوستان راهنمایی کنند

    از شما هم ممنون بابت راهنماییتون ;)

    احتمالا بشه به کمکه دستورات if و else یا دستوراتی از این قبیل فهماند که اول یک دستور خاص رو لود کنه و سپس مطالب سایت رو نشون بده

    • امتیاز 1
  12. 15

    درسته

    من هم میخوام همین کار رو انجام بدم

    هاست اصلیم ۱۵ گیگه و هاست دانلود ۳۰ گیگ

    حالا دارم فایل های دانلود رو داخل هاست دانلود قرار میدم

    عکس ها رو میخوام توی هاست دانلود قرار بدم

    ولی اگه این کار رو انجام بدم هاست اصلیم که ۱۵ گیگه بی استفاده میشه

    حالا از همون هاست اصلیم ساب دامین درست کنم و عکس ها رو اونجا بذارم یا نه عکس ها هم داخل هاست دانلود بذارم

    یعنی اگه از هاست دانلود استفاده نکنم و از همون هاست اصلیم ساب دامین درست کنم و اونجا عکس ها رو اپلود کنم باز به سایت فشار میاد

    چه فشاری آخه و 15 گیگ فضاست . شوخی که نیست به این اسونی ها هم پر نمیشه . من خودم 20 گیگ دارم و روش یک شبکه اجتماعی . این همه آهنگ و عکس و ... آپلود کردن هنوز بعد 1 سال 0/1 اون هم پر نشده . ساب دامین خوب بهتر و حرفه ای تره و اگه قرار باشه از هاست دانلود استفاده کنید باید سالانه پول 2 هاست را پرداخت کنید که در این بین هاست 15 گیگ کامل بی استفاده میمونه . یعنی در عمل پول 2 هاست را میدید و از یک هاست استفاده میکنید .

    یا اینکه به پشتیبان هاست بگید پنلتون رو به پنل هایی با حجم کم انتقال بده و از هاست دانلود استفاده کنید

    درسته

    من هم میخوام همین کار رو انجام بدم

    هاست اصلیم ۱۵ گیگه و هاست دانلود ۳۰ گیگ

    حالا دارم فایل های دانلود رو داخل هاست دانلود قرار میدم

    عکس ها رو میخوام توی هاست دانلود قرار بدم

    ولی اگه این کار رو انجام بدم هاست اصلیم که ۱۵ گیگه بی استفاده میشه

    حالا از همون هاست اصلیم ساب دامین درست کنم و عکس ها رو اونجا بذارم یا نه عکس ها هم داخل هاست دانلود بذارم

    یعنی اگه از هاست دانلود استفاده نکنم و از همون هاست اصلیم ساب دامین درست کنم و اونجا عکس ها رو اپلود کنم باز به سایت فشار میاد

    نتیجه : پیشنهاد بنده اینه که شما هاست دانلودت رو کنسل کنی یا بفروشیش به کس دیگه و از هاست بعلی سایتت استفاده کنی

    • امتیاز 2
  13. ببینید اینکار من یه مقدار خاصه برا همین نمیتونم چیزی در موردش پیدا کنم!

    من یه فایل جاوا اسکریپت دارم در قالب یک صفحه ی html

    که این صفحه حاوی این کدها،هر 5 ثانیه یکبار ریلود میشه!

    حالا میخوام این صفحه رو که هر 5 ثانیه یکبار ریلود میشه بذارم بعنوان صفحه اصلی سایتم با این تفاوت که با یکبار ریلود شدن بره به محتوای سایت!

    یعنی نمیخوام اون آدرس سایت توی آدرس بار، تغییری بکنه،فقط میخوام یکبار این لودینگ اول سایت نمایش داده بشه و بعد از 5 ثانیه بجای ریلود شدن خودش، بعد از 5 ثانیه محتوای سایت رو به نمایش در بیاره!

    نمیدونم تونستم منظورمو برسونم یا نه! امیدوارم متوجه شده باشید!

    اگر مبهمه،بگید تا با مثال براتون توضیح بدم. :)

    الان با استفاده از این کد میشه به وردپرس فهموند که اول صفحه ای که میخواییم نمایش بده و اولویت دوم ایندکس خود قالبه

    این کد توی htaccess قرار میگیره و این عمل انجام میشه :


    DirectoryIndex index.html index.php

    حالا میشه کاری کرد که بهش بفهمونیم این ارجعیت فقط یکبار انجام بشه؟

    یعنی چی؟

    یعنی اینکه هر کاربری که وارد سایت میشه، دفعه ی اول اون فایل لودینگمون براش نمایش داده بشه اما دفعات بعدی دیگه اون اولویت انجام نشه،و محتوای خود سایت یعنی ایندکس اصلی سایت براش نمایش داده بشه

    یه جورایی با کَش انجام شه،همون کاری که با پاپ آپ میکنن

    یعنی هر 24 ساعت یکبار این اولویت انجام شه!

    بازم امیدوارم تونسته باشم منظورمو برسونم :D

    قطعا میشه و در اینمورد خاص باید دوستان کمک کنن . من گمان کردم شما میخواید اول یک صفحه ورود داشته باشید و سپس سایت اصلی مثلا

    yoursite.com/index.php

    yoursite.com/home.php

    • امتیاز 1
×
×
  • اضافه کردن...